Who called Pauli Murray's 1950 book "States' Laws on Race and Color", the "bible" of the civil rights movement?

  • Martin Luther King Jr.

  • Rosa Parks

  • Thurgood Marshall

  • Malcolm X

Answer

Thurgood Marshall, who later became the first African American Supreme Court justice, called Pauli Murray's 1950 book "States' Laws on Race and Color" the "bible" of the civil rights movement. Murray was a lawyer, civil rights activist, and Episcopal priest who was also a friend of Marshall. Her book was a comprehensive study of the laws that discriminated against African Americans in the United States.
